Webb10 dec. 2024 · To take care of a tick bite. Remove the tick promptly and carefully. Use fine-tipped forceps or tweezers to grasp the tick as close to the skin as possible. Gently pull out the tick using a slow and steady upward motion. Avoid twisting or squeezing the tick. Do not handle the tick with bare hands. Watch for symptoms of tickborne illness for 30 days after a tick bite. Symptoms may include fever, chills, rash, headache, joint pain, muscle aches, or fatigue.
